The Sr. Manager, Medical Affairs Operations will be responsible for implementing and managing key information and functional systems, establishing processes, planning and executing key internal and external meetings/congresses, and driving the visualization of key data and metrics that will be vital to informing the continuing strategic contribution of the US Medical Affairs Function to Idorsia’s success.
nn
The Sr. Manager, Medical Affairs Operations will be an experienced professional with a successful track record in Medical Affairs processes and governance, IT systems and platforms relevant to Medical Affairs and Medical Information, data visualization, and program management. A collaborative, hands- on individual, the successful candidate will have the agility to operate in a dynamic, science-driven environment. S/he will stand out with a quality and efficiency mindset, sense of urgency and the ability to collaborate with a range of functions.
